|
CoCreate Modeling : Lisp beim Start von Modeling mitladen
der_Wolfgang am 24.10.2008 um 22:09 Uhr (0)
Zitat:Original erstellt von Walter Geppert:[QUOTE]load ist immer noch das Richtige! Aber mit der Angabe von absoluten Pfadnamen auch etwas pfui !Die Wahl von sd-load-customization-file finde ich schon mal nicht schlecht. Ich wuerde noch ein :which :first spendieren.. Alternative wäre auch ein Code:(load (format nil "~Agdm_cdm_vieleck_2d.lsp" (namestring (oli:sd-inq-user-profiledir-pathname))))eine Loesung.AberCode:(display "sd_customize wird geladen")sollte schon helfen ()!------------------ Seamonkey Fi ...
|
| In das Form CoCreate Modeling wechseln |
|
CoCreate Programmierung : Fehler in einer while Schleife
der_Wolfgang am 24.08.2011 um 22:59 Uhr (0)
räupser .. was macht ihr denn da für komsiche Schleifen.. insbesonder einem wenig LISP erfahrenen möchte da doch sehr DOLIST an Herz legenCode:(let (sheet-name) (dolist (a-sheet (sd-am-inq-all-sheets)) (setq sheet-name (sd-am-sheet-struct-name (sd-am-inq-sheet a-sheet))) (sd-call-cmds (AM_SAVE_SHEET_DXF :sheet a-sheet :FILENAME (format nil "Blatt_~A" sheet-name))) ) ) ; end letKein redraw, kein veraendern des current sheets.beim gezeigen code landen die files in dem just geraden eben aktuellem Verzeich ...
|
| In das Form CoCreate Programmierung wechseln |
|
CoCreate Modeling : 2 Ansichtensätze - EIN Modell
der_Wolfgang am 10.02.2010 um 20:28 Uhr (0)
Zitat:Original erstellt von friedhelm at work:wie ist eigentlich die richtige Syntax für den Befehl, wenn man ihn in die "am_customize" eintragen will?(docu-enable-migration-tools)Hast Du vielleicht vorher einen LISP fehler der weggeschluckt wird?TIP: am anfang der am_customize mal den (trace docu-enable-migration-tools) einschalten. Der aufruf muesste dann ja sichtbar sein. Startparameter "-v" brauche ich Dir ja nicht sagen, gell? oder hast du irgendwo einen (docu-disable-migration-tools) drin haengen.. ...
|
| In das Form CoCreate Modeling wechseln |
|
CoCreate Modeling : SD-Stückliste per lsp schließen
der_Wolfgang am 11.01.2011 um 13:43 Uhr (0)
Zitat:Original erstellt von Harald H:Zu meiner Frage, kann man das Fenster "SD-Stückliste" (Screenshot im Anhang) des SolidPower Advanced Pakets mit einem Lisp Befehl schließen?michrauslehn ja. /michrauslehn Willst auch wissen wie? Das Ding ist ein browser:Code:(display (oli:sd-list-graphical-browsers))Gibt Dir ne Liste aller zurueck. Da sollte der Name schnell gefunden sein und die Lösung naht ganz schnell in Form von Code:(oli:sd-hide-graphical-browser "desBrowsersName")Beides sind dokumentie ...
|
| In das Form CoCreate Modeling wechseln |
|
CoCreate Programmierung : LISP: Konfigurationen manipulieren
der_Wolfgang am 24.10.2007 um 20:10 Uhr (0)
Zitat:Original erstellt von uli1601:Vielen Dank Markus und Wolfgang, eure Hinweise und Tips haben mich sehr weitergebracht.büdde büdde!Damit wir hier noch etwas Lisp lernen/erweitern noch ein kleiner Exkurs.Code:(Schnittmengenbildung () (dolist (pos my-conf_org_pos) (nconc partsinconf_org (list (SD-INQ-OBJ-SYSID (first pos))))) (pop partsinconf_org) (dolist (pos my-conf_pos) (nconc partsinconf (list (SD-INQ-OBJ-SYSID (first pos))))) (pop partsinconf) (setf schnittmenge (intersection partsinconf partsinco ...
|
| In das Form CoCreate Programmierung wechseln |
|
Programmierung : Liste in LISP sortieren
der_Wolfgang am 11.07.2007 um 20:37 Uhr (0)
Ein :docupoint ist kein gpnt2d.Ein kleiner dialog zeigt ganz fix mit einem pprint, was dahinter steckt:Code:(oli::sd-defdialog a_am_point :variables ((punkt :value-type :docupoint :after-input (pprint punkt))))Ein :docupoint ist kein gpnt2d, sondern also ein GPNTDOCU.Und damit die Lernkurve nicht zu sehr abflacht ;-p, kannst Du jetzt herausfinden wie das so mit Strukuren denn so ist.. ... Eine vorhandene OSDModeling Dokumentation, die von "OneSpace Designer Integration Kit - Concepts and Tutorials" verlin ...
|
| In das Form Programmierung wechseln |
|
PTC Creo Elements/Programmierung : Lisp Befehl Als Root Festlegen
der_Wolfgang am 23.09.2020 um 20:21 Uhr (1)
du brauchst den "browser node" als Parameter.. da liegt wohl die Stolperstelle. https://support.ptc.com/help/creo/ced_modeling/r20.2.0.0/en/ced_modeling/baggage/documentation/integration_kit/reference/gbrowser.html#sd-browser-exec-cmd------------------ Firefox ESR Java Forum Stuttgart JUGS OSD Hilfeseite (de) / help page (en) NotePad++ BuFDi
|
| In das Form PTC Creo Elements/Programmierung wechseln |
|
CoCreate Programmierung : LISP: Schnittebene in Dialog auswählen
der_Wolfgang am 26.06.2009 um 18:40 Uhr (0)
Zitat:Original erstellt von holt:(display S_CLIPPLANE) ergibt 68900016Diese Zahl bei :selection eingesetzt bewirkt genau das was ich wollte: Der Dialog akzeptiert Schnittebenen!igggsss... aber dieses ZAHL gilt nur fuer die aktuelle Session. Beim naechsten Start ist das was anderes. Just gerade ist es bei mir 113184824. S_CLIPPLANE ist doch eine (globale) variable, sonst koenntests ja auch den (display .. ) nicht ausfuehren!Schreib in Deinen Dialog S_CLIPPLANE rein! -------------------------Ich habe Absic ...
|
| In das Form CoCreate Programmierung wechseln |
|
PTC Creo Elements/Direct Modeling : LISP Datei am Start ausführen - Warten auf Creo
der_Wolfgang am 15.08.2019 um 18:22 Uhr (3)
Zitat:Original erstellt von clausb:Brechen wir das Problem aufs Elementare herunter.Lach .. if then else. In meinem jugendlichem( :kicher: ) Leichtsinn hatte ich den code semi-zitiert im Sinne des Erfinders - mein Fehler.Du hast rechts. und ein (trace sd-inq-curr-part) wäre auch eine hilfreiche Ergänzung.und @constructr .. alles was in dem Bereich dann in der console (oli:sd-show-console-window) sichtbar ist hier zur Verfügung stellen. Ich helfe gerne, aber Rätselraten ist nicht mein Hobby. ------------- ...
|
| In das Form PTC Creo Elements/Direct Modeling wechseln |
|
CoCreate Modeling : am_posnum1.lsp
der_Wolfgang am 16.03.2011 um 20:57 Uhr (0)
Zitat:Original erstellt von Walter Geppert:In V17 hat sich zu meiner grossen Freude so einiges geändert :D Hallo Walter,mags Du mal mitCode:(sd-freeze-setting-value :Path-pattern "Annotation/Symbol/Appearance");; und (sd-unfreeze-setting-value :Path-pattern "Annotation/Symbol/Appearance*")arbeiten? Genau dafuer ist das Päärchen gedacht. - Ganz ohne Parameter ist es vermutlich am einfachsten anzuwenden. Dazwischen kannst Du dann wildeste Sachen anstellen.. also LISP Settings mäßig zumindest.. PS: mir r ...
|
| In das Form CoCreate Modeling wechseln |
|
Programmierung : LISP: berechnete Werte auf Zeichnung
der_Wolfgang am 14.11.2007 um 19:52 Uhr (0)
Zitat:Original erstellt von holt:@Wolfgang: Deine Beschreibung entspricht im wesentlichen der von Dieter, oder?[/i]nnnnnjnnjjaaa etwas.. rumdrucks Also meine Beschreibung ist (denke ich mal ) deutlich naeher dran an dem, was Dir Annotation von Hause aus bietet. Ich meinen es gibt auch ein brauchbares Beispiel in der OnlineDoku (im Bom/TitleBlcok bereich). Mit sicherheit gabe es mal ein Tutorial fur die Schriftfeldanpassung (auch, aber nicht nur) im Zusammenhang mit DDM. Du bräuchtest dich *nicht* um das ...
|
| In das Form Programmierung wechseln |
|
OneSpace Modeling : Lisp-Editor
der_Wolfgang am 08.12.2004 um 21:11 Uhr (0)
Hi Ihr, Ich haben neue Syntax Highlighter Dateien basierend auf OSD Modeling 13.00 und 2DDrafting 13.00 erstellt. Es sind alle Worte (zb. vom OSDM IKIT) einzeln aufgeührt, sodass indirekt ein Syntax-Check erfolgt. Für den Freeware Editor Context sind diese Dateien bereits auf der offiziellen Homepage verfügbar: http://www.context.cx/ http://www.context.cx/highlighters_a-h.html Für UltraEdit habe ich diese Dateien bereits vorbereitet, aber die werden noch getestet. Dateien fuer anderen ...
|
| In das Form OneSpace Modeling wechseln |
|
PTC Creo Elements/Direct Modeling : Skizzen in der Vorlagenliste
der_Wolfgang am 23.05.2021 um 10:55 Uhr (2)
@dennis SD-CORP-SITE-USER Verzeichnisse sind 4 Stufen des gesamten Modeling Customizations konzept. Die Struktur in jeder der Stufen ist identisch. Diese Stufen werden NICHT ineinander verschachtelt. == Customization Guide for Administrators and Advanced Users und dort dann "Multi-level Customization Approach"Die Corp und Site Dir wird über Umgebungsvariablen gesetzt. Entweder im System selber, oder in einer zentral gehandhabten BatchDatei, die alle Anwender zum Starten von Modeling verwenden.Diese Vorgehe ...
|
| In das Form PTC Creo Elements/Direct Modeling wechseln |